NodeDisruptionPolicy type
The policy configuration for when to allow certain operations which require node re-image and trigger redeployment. For example, some operations, such as updating the .properties.ManagedClusterSecurityProfile.customCATrustCertificates field on an existing managed cluster, trigger rolling updates of the nodes. This setting allows control over when such updates are accepted. The default is 'Allow'. For a full list of covered operations see aka.ms/aks/nodedisruptionpolicy".
KnownNodeDisruptionPolicy can be used interchangeably with NodeDisruptionPolicy,
this enum contains the known values that the service supports.
Known values supported by the service
Allow: Allows operations that will require node re-image and trigger redeployment.
AllowDuringMaintenanceWindow: Blocks certain operations that will require node re-image and trigger redeployment unless within the aksManagedNodeOSUpgradeSchedule maintenance window. For a full list of covered operations see aka.ms/aks/nodedisruptionpolicy . For more information on using the aksManagedNodeOSUpgradeSchedule maintenance window, please see https://learn.microsoft.com/azure/aks/planned-maintenance?tabs=azure-cli
Block: Blocks certain operations that will require node re-image and trigger redeployment. For a full list of covered operations see aka.ms/aks/nodedisruptionpolicy
type NodeDisruptionPolicy = string
